Description The Turner and Harley Ross families occupied these duplex homes. Center Street was basically a dirt road behind the business and homes that lined State Street. It appears that most of the homes were built between 1900 and 1910 as the Murray City downtown area developed with the new city hall, the jail and fire station. Ada Wright, c/o Joseph E. Badovinatz owned the duplex in 1971.
